A 8.00 L tank at 13.9 °C is filled with 11.7 g of chlorine pentafluoride gas and 3.82 g of boron trifluoride gas. You can assume both gases behave as ideal gases under these conditions. Calculate the mole fraction and partial pressure of each gas, and the total pressure in the tank.
